> JOhn,
> I find the FT 857 to be a bit on the  hot side.
> Even running 30 watts and sending CW at 25 WPM for 10 minutes the  back is 
> to
> hot.
> I had HI-Speed CFM fans on my FT 100-D and I had one fan run  at 1/2 speed
> full time
> As soon as I keyed up both fans went full speed.
> I  find the 857-D rig fans do not put out enough CFM of air
> The sad part is that  it's a big job to replace the stock fans with hi 
> speed
> fans on the 857-D  rig
